Why Multi-Tools Are Essential on Construction Job Sites
A construction site presents constant small tasks that do not justify pulling out dedicated full-size tools. Cutting drywall tape, trimming zip ties, opening adhesive tubes, tightening set screws, and crimping wire connectors all happen multiple times per day. A multi-tool carried in a belt pouch or pocket handles these tasks in seconds. The time savings add up across a work week, and the convenience encourages workers to address small issues immediately rather than letting them accumulate. Common Job Site Tasks for Multi-Tools
- Cutting and stripping electrical wire for outlet and switch installations
- Trimming plastic strapping and banding from material bundles
- Opening paint and adhesive cans without damaging the lid seal
- Tightening loose screws on cabinet hinges, door hardware, and fixtures
- Cutting drywall mesh tape, roofing felt, and vapor barrier materials
- Pulling staples and nails from trim work during adjustments
- Crimping connectors for low-voltage wiring and data cables
Full-Size versus Compact Multi-Tool Options for Tradespeople
The primary distinction between multi-tool categories is size and the tools included. Full-size models typically weigh 6 to 8 ounces and include pliers, wire cutters, knife blades, screwdrivers, and a saw. Compact or keychain models weigh 1 to 3 ounces and focus on scissors, a small knife, a tweezers, and a nail file. The choice between them depends on what tasks the user handles most often. | Feature | Full-Size Tool (~7 oz) | Compact Tool (~2 oz) |
|---|---|---|
| Pliers | Yes, with wire cutter | No or spring-type only |
| Knife blade | 2.5-3 inch locking | 1-2 inch non-locking |
| Scissors | Often included | Primary cutting tool |
| Screwdrivers | Phillips and flathead multiple sizes | One or two double-ended bits |
| Saw | Wood/metal file or saw | Rarely included |
| Carry method | Belt sheath or pocket clip | Keychain or coin pocket |
| Typical price | $30 – $120 | $15 – $40 |
When a Full-Size Tool Makes Sense
Tradespeople who regularly work with wire, cable, and light hardware benefit most from a full-size multi-tool. Electricians, HVAC installers, and finish carpenters use the pliers and cutters multiple times per hour. The larger knife blade handles cutting through packaging, insulation, and roofing underlayment without dulling quickly. The saw blade on full-size tools cuts through PVC conduit, dowels, and trim stock up to 1 inch thick, which eliminates trips to the miter saw for small cuts.
When a Compact Tool Works Better
Compact tools are ideal for workers who already carry a dedicated knife and a separate set of pliers. Painters, drywall finishers, and laborers who perform mostly prep and cleanup work reach for scissors and screwdrivers more often than pliers. A keychain-sized tool stays with the user at all times, even on days when a belt sheath feels unnecessary. Many workers carry both a full-size tool in their belt pouch and a compact tool on their keychain for backup.
Key Features to Evaluate When Choosing a Multi-Tool
Specifications sheets list blade steel, tool count, and weight, but real-world usability depends on factors that do not appear in marketing materials. The locking mechanism on the knife blade, the handedness of the screwdriver access, and the ease of opening each tool one-handed all affect daily satisfaction. Blade Accessibility and Locking Mechanisms
Most multi-tools place the knife blade on the outside of the handle so it opens without unfolding the pliers. Models with a liner lock or frame lock provide safer cutting than slip-joint designs that rely on spring tension. For construction work, a one-hand opening blade with a secure lock is a must-have feature. The blade steel should be at least 420HC stainless, which balances edge retention with corrosion resistance on humid job sites.
Screwdriver Bit Compatibility
Built-in screwdrivers on older multi-tool designs use proprietary ground bits that cannot be replaced. Newer designs accept standard 1/4-inch hex bits, which opens the system to thousands of bit types available at any hardware store. Multi-tools with hex bit drivers weigh slightly more but eliminate the need to carry a separate bit driver for electrical and cabinet work.
Building a Layered Tool Carry System for Different Tasks
No single multi-tool covers every situation on a construction site. A layered approach places different tools at different levels of accessibility. The primary multi-tool lives on the belt or in a pouch for quick access. A compact backup tool stays on the keychain or in a small tool bag. Dedicated tools for specific trades, such as wire strippers for electricians or tin snips for sheet metal workers, handle tasks that exceed a multi-tool’s capabilities. - Identify the five most common tasks performed on a typical workday that require a cutting, gripping, or driving tool.
- Select a primary multi-tool that handles at least four of those five tasks directly without adapters or add-ons.
- Choose a compact backup tool that covers the tasks the primary tool handles poorly, such as fine cutting with scissors.
- Add one dedicated tool for the task the multi-tool cannot do safely, such as heavy wire cutting or large-diameter pipe cutting.
- Test the carry system for one week and adjust based on which tools actually get used and which stay folded.
This approach prevents carrying unnecessary weight while ensuring critical capabilities are always within reach. A carpenter framing interior walls may need only a full-size multi-tool and a separate utility knife. An electrician roughing in a new build may need those plus dedicated wire strippers and a voltage tester.
Budget Planning for Multi-Tool Purchases
Multi-tool prices span a wide range depending on brand, materials, and included tool set. A basic full-size tool costs around $30, while premium models with replaceable wire cutters and titanium handles exceed $120. Compact tools range from $15 to $40. Combo packs that pair a full-size and compact tool together typically sell for $30 to $50, representing a 30 to 50 percent discount versus buying each separately. Maintaining Multi-Tools for Long-Term Jobsite Use
Job site conditions expose multi-tools to dust, moisture, drywall compound, and adhesive residue. A tool that goes unmaintained for weeks develops stiff hinges, corroded blades, and stripped screwdriver tips. Basic care extends the usable life from months to years. Rinse the tool with fresh water at the end of each day if it has been exposed to drywall dust or concrete residue. Dry it thoroughly and apply a drop of lightweight oil to all pivot points. Sharpen the knife blade with a fine diamond stone every two to four weeks depending on use. Replace any broken or worn bits immediately rather than forcing them to work. - Clean the tool after exposure to adhesive, caulk, or paint before the residue hardens
- Lubricate pivot points weekly with a silicone-based or lightweight machine oil
- Store the tool in a dry sheath or pouch rather than loose in a tool bag where grit accumulates
- Check the wire cutter alignment monthly replace the tool if cutters no longer meet cleanly
- Apply a rust inhibitor to carbon steel blades if working in coastal or high-humidity environments
